TITLE:Prosecutor's Management Information System

ACRONYM: PROMIS (now LIONS)

ABSTRACT: The LIONS system is a database with on-line capabilities which permits the USAOs and EOUSA to compile, maintain and track information relating to defendants, crimes, criminal charges, court events, and witnesses.

PURPOSE: LIONS was established and is maintained to track cases and matters which are presented to and/or pursued by the USAOs. LIONS serves as a day to day management tool as well as a litigation aid and a review tool. By allowing the USAOs and EOUSA to summarize and analyze the cases pending and completed the USAOs and EOUSA can more efficiently promote the interests of the United States government.

ACCESS CONSTRAINTS: The magnetic tapes and discs which LIONS information is stored on are maintained in a secure vault at the Metropolitan Police Department Computer Center. In addition to the physical security safeguards, there is a twenty four hour patrol. The data display terminals are located in offices staffed by personnel during working hours. Access to the LIONS system is provided only to specific trained operators.

AGENCY PROGRAM: The USAOs are charged with the enforcement of United States law both civil and criminal in conjunction with the Department of Justice. EOUSA serves as a liaison between the 93 USAOs and the Department of Justice. Compilation and maintenance of summaries and statistical information is a valuable tool in pursuing the law enforcement goals of the United States government.

SOURCES OF DATA: The bulk of the information maintained in the LIONS system is obtained during the case intake and screening stage. Additional information is provided as the matter moves through subsequent proceedings.

ORDER PROCESS: To the extent that portions of this system are not exempt from disclosure the request for information must be writing with the envelope and the letter clearly marked "Privacy Access Request." The requester must provide the general subject matter of the document or its file number and a current return address. All requests should be directed to the Executive Office for United States Attorneys, Freedom of Information Act and Privacy Act Staff, EOUSA, 600 E Street, NW, Room 7100, Washington, D.C. 20530.
